Population breakdown by gender

Population in zip code 34275 is 16,020 residents | Male to Female ratio is 1:1.05 | Zip Code 34275 land area is 26.5642 sq. miles | Population density is 603.07 residents per square mile

Median age

  Median Age
Zip Code Median Age 57.8
Median Age - Male 57.7
Median Age - Female 58

Median age of zip code 34275 is 7.2% higher compared to nearby zip codes and 55.4% higher compared to the United States median age. Comparing gender-specific madian age yields the following results. Male median age of zip code 34275 is 8.9% higher compared to nearby zip codes and 61.2% higher compared to the United States male median age. Female zip code 34275 median age is 6% higher in comparison to nearby zip codes and 50.6% higher compared to female national median age average.

Real Estate

Metric Value
Housing occupied 72.28%
Housing vacant 27.72%
Housing occupied by owner 83.94%
Housing occupied by tenant 16.06%
Total Rented Units 1203
Median Contract Gross Rent $787
Median Gross Rent $929
Median Home Value $249,800

Contract rent is the monthly cash rent agreed to, regardless of any furnishings, utilities, fees, meals, or services that may be included. Gross rent is the contract rent plus the estimated average monthly cost of utilities and fuels if these are paid by the renter. In zip code 34275 median gross rent is 18.04% larger then the median contract rent.
